Hi,

First time posting on the forum. Firstly, I'd like to thank everyone on the forum as I've learned a lot researching via this place.
I have wanted a breitling chronomat for a few years now and decided it was time to buy. I had my heart set on a black dial gmt model with pilot bracelet.
I had planned on buying from Andrew Michaels in the UK but on arrival in New York today saw a Chronomat GMT R that had just arrived from Basel. I didn't even know it existed. It was beautiful. It's got a red second hand and black markers on the bezel. The price was slightly higher than the standard GMT from Andrew Michaels but I was offered some additional straps to sweeten the deal. In the end, I had the watch on pilot bracelet, 2 different rubber straps and a brown leather strap. My partner was gifted a beautiful breitling leather purse. All in all, a great experience and most importantly, I love the watch. I'll try and post pics when I'm on my PC.
